In an Open Matte version, the black bars at the top and bottom are removed (or significantly reduced). This unmasks the top and bottom of the filmed frame, revealing visual information that was cropped out of the theatrical release. Instead of a thin widescreen strip, the image fills up a modern 16:9 television screen entirely. The IMAX Open Matte Experience

An open matte version removes this top and bottom cropping. It fills up more of a standard 16:9 television screen, removing or reducing the black bars at the top and bottom. blade runner 2049 open matte 4k

First, a quick technical primer. Most films are shot using a sensor that captures a taller image than what ends up in theaters. The director and cinematographer then decide on a final "aspect ratio" (like 2.39:1) and essentially crop the top and bottom off the raw footage.

: Unlike "Pan and Scan" which crops the sides, Open Matte reveals information at the top and bottom of the frame that was captured by the Arri Alexa XT cameras but matted out for theaters.
